Hamilton County, Kansas Employment Sector Breakdown

SectorTotal WorkersPercentage
Private For-Profit78871.0%
Government15113.6%
Self-Employed1109.9%
Private Non-Profit605.4%

Hamilton County, Kansas Employment Trends (2010–2024)

Long-term employment trends in

Hamilton County, Kansas Historical Employment Sector Trends

YearPrivateGovSelf-EmpNon-Profit
202471.0%13.6%9.9%5.4%
202370.9%10.2%12.0%6.4%
202269.8%9.9%10.1%10.0%
202170.9%8.7%10.5%9.7%
202071.5%10.7%9.9%7.4%
201965.5%14.0%11.7%8.1%
201867.5%14.4%9.1%8.3%
201766.2%16.5%10.1%6.5%
201666.1%16.1%12.8%4.2%
201561.7%16.6%17.9%3.1%
201464.7%13.8%18.0%2.9%
201361.8%16.3%18.6%2.8%
201262.0%14.9%18.4%4.1%
201160.7%15.7%18.2%5.5%
201064.8%15.3%13.3%6.7%

Employment Sector FAQs for Hamilton County, Kansas

The largest employment sector in Hamilton County, Kansas is Private For-Profit, which employs 71.0% of the local workforce.

There are approximately 1,110 civilian workers aged 16 and over currently employed in Hamilton County, Kansas.

In the private for-profit sector, the male-to-female ratio is 1.56:1. This metric helps highlight gender participation across the most prominent industry classes.

Since 2010, the total number of workers in Hamilton County, Kansas has shown a decrease, moving from 1,342 to 1,110 according to Census Bureau records.
